Kathmandu Valley is a settlement of the two cultures combined together that is Hinduism and Buddhism. The locals of the Kathmandu city follow both religions at the same time and celebrate the festival too. The cultural and religious hub Kathmandu has 3 major cities inside it, namely Kathmandu, Lalitpur and Bhaktapur. What to see on Kathmandu Transit tour?

There are 4 UNESCO World Heritage Sites. Pashupatinath Temple, Swaymbhunath Stupa, Boudhanath Stupa and Kathmandu durbar square. You will visit these places in a single day because all of these are located in a very near distance. Visiting these places gives you a summary of Hinduism, Buddhism and their cultures. Mountain flight on Kathmandu transit tour

If you are arriving in Kathmandu for a short period of time and wondering if you could see Mt Everest then you should do the Everest Mountain flights. The Everest Mountain flights take you to the above the Himalayas for the stunning and breathtaking view of the High Himalayas. The 1-hour flight takes you to above the Nepal high Himalayas from where you can see the stunning views of the mountains like Everest 8,848 m, 29020 ft, Shishapangma 8,013 m,26289 ft, Makalu 8,481 m, 27,825 ft, Lhotse 8,516 m, 27939 ft, Cho Oyu 8201m, Dorje Lakpa 6,966 m, Gauri Shankar 7,134m, Melungtse 7,023m, Numbur 6956 m, Karyolung 6511m, Gyachung Kang 7952m, Pumori 7,161m, Nuptse 7855m. The flight is in the early morning so you can do day sightseeing during the day in Kathmandu. The Mountain flight cost is not that expensive too.

Kathmandu transit tour itinerary

  • 8.00 AM: Pick Up and drive to Pashupatinath

    Kathmandu transit tour begins after we pick up you from the hotel then drive to the Pashupatinath temple, You will take the entrance ticket from the Tilganga side and enter into the Pashupatinath temple seeing one of the oldest sculptures of the Lord Vishnu which is around the 1600 years old. There are many shops before you reach the bank of the Bagmati River from where you can see the Main shrines Pashupatinath temple along with many other temples.


    Pashupatinath

    Firstly, you will see the dead body burning. According to the Hindu cultures, they burn the dead body after they die in holy places like the Pashupatinath. That is the reason you see a lot of the dead body burning here. Our guide will describe the many things when you are in Pashupatinath temple. You will see 4 Ghat and the main entrance of the Pashupatinath temple. Inside the Pashupatinath temple, only Hindu people can go. When you go to the top of the Bagmati River on the viewpoints from there you can see all of the temple areas. We give you an overwhelming briefing if you need it, otherwise, we tell you in a very short cut. After Pashupatinath temple, you will climb to the hill and down to the other side of the river where the vehicle will be waiting for us.

  • 11.00 AM: Boudhanath stupa

    Drive to the Boudhanath stupa. This is another highlighted place to see Buddhism and the monasteries around the Stupa. The oldest stupa is one of the highest stupa standing on the height of 136 feet tall with a diameter of 156 feet on octagonal shapes. You will see the many groves and the prayer wheels which can be rolled by the devotees in the morning and evening time mainly, but you can roll it any time as you are there. Many other monasteries are there around with the Azima temples on the side. Once we visit the stupa it will be time for you to have something for your launch before you move to Swayambhunath.

  • 1.30 PM: Drive to Swayambhunath

    Drive to Swayambhunath and enter from the money throwing pond from the left side where you will see the massive bells along with the Basabandhu stupa. Climbing to the top of the stupa you can see the multiple chaityas on the yards of the stupa. The highlighted one is the massive sculptures of the Dipankara Buddha and the stupa itself. It is small in size but built with the same aspects as Boudhanath stupa.

  • 3.00 AM: Drive to Kathmandu durbar square

    Drive to Kathmandu durbar square and sightseeing in Kathmandu durbar square, you would see the ongoing construction of the Kasthamandap temple, Vishnu Temple, Kal Bhairav temple, Sweet Bhairav temple, Taleju temple and many other temples around the Kathmandu durbar square. You will see the best examples of the wood carving and stone carving on the Kathmandu durbar square. In the main courtyard, you will also see the royal family photos and the things that the royal family used. There are museums also to see. At 4: PM you can see the living goddess Kumari blessing the public people.
